Harley-Davidson Touring description

1965 Harley-Davidson FLH Electra-Glide. First year for the Electra-Glide and last year for the Panhead engine.
This is one of the most sought after and collectable antique Harley-Davidson motorcycles.  Everyone wants a Panhead with electric start.

This bike is an all original survivor.  It still has it's original Hi-Fi Red & Birch White paint.  Although it's worn and faded, its all original. 
The seat, tires, wiring, exhaust, windshield, speedo are original.  The only aftermarket part on the bike is a replacement starter solenoid. 
The electric start works great.  All lights work.

I recently serviced the bike and it runs great.  It's a turn key rider.  It once had a sidecar on it so it has adjustable rake fork trees and steering damper.
I rebuilt the rear brake, installed a new battery, changed the oil & filter, changed the trans oil, rebuilt the carb with a rubber ducky float and greased the whole bike.

The original owner of the bike was a HD dealer in PA named Sparky Haines.

Backflips on a Harley? [video]

Mon, 07 Dec 2009

In late November two motorcycle daredevils from opposite sides of the world were fighting to see who would be the first to backflip a Harley Davidson XR1200 motorcycle. Australia’s Kain Saul reached the Promised Land first when he made a successful jump in Sydney on November 27. Harley-Davidson believes Saul’s jump is the first ever successful backflip for any full size street motorcycle.

Harley-Davidson Tri-Glide Led Inauguration Parade

Mon, 02 Feb 2009

While at the time, most of the attention was on President Barack Obama, motorcycle enthusiasts would have surely noticed the one-of-a-kind 2009 Harley-Davidson Police concept Tri-Glide Ultra Classic which led the inauguration parade to the White House on January 20th. Lieutenant Scott Fear, Commander of the U.S. Park Police Motor Unit, led a dozen side car-equipped Electra Glides in a formation riding the heavily modified Trike, which was sourced by Harley-Davidson of Frederick.
